CryptPad终极指南:零基础搭建企业级加密协作平台
【免费下载链接】cryptpadCollaborative office suite, end-to-end encrypted and open-source.项目地址: https://gitcode.com/gh_mirrors/cr/cryptpad
在数字化办公时代,数据安全与团队协作往往难以兼顾。CryptPad作为一款开源的端到端加密协作套件,完美解决了这一难题,让企业能够在保障隐私的同时实现高效协同工作。
🛡️ 为什么选择CryptPad?
企业级数据安全保障
CryptPad采用先进的端到端加密技术,确保所有文档内容在离开浏览器前就已加密。服务器仅存储加密数据,即使遭遇安全事件,敏感信息也不会泄露。
多样化协作场景支持
从代码编写到文档编辑,从表格处理到白板设计,CryptPad为团队提供全方位的协作解决方案。
自主可控部署方案
支持私有化部署,企业完全掌控数据存储和管理权限。
🚀 5分钟快速部署实战
环境准备检查清单
- Node.js 14.0+ 运行环境
- npm 6.0+ 包管理器
- 至少2GB可用内存
- 稳定的网络连接
Docker一键部署(推荐)
git clone https://gitcode.com/gh_mirrors/cr/cryptpad cd cryptpad docker-compose up -d传统安装方式
git clone https://gitcode.com/gh_mirrors/cr/cryptpad cd cryptpad npm install npm start部署完成后,访问http://localhost:8080即可开始使用。
💼 核心功能深度解析
实时文档协作系统
基于富文本编辑器的多人实时协作,支持版本历史和评论功能。所有编辑操作均实时同步,团队成员可看到彼此的光标位置和修改内容。
智能表格处理引擎
提供完整的电子表格功能,支持公式计算、数据分析和图表生成。通过www/sheet/模块实现表格数据的加密存储和实时同步。
演示文稿创作工具
内置演示文稿编辑器,支持多种主题模板和动画效果。团队成员可共同设计和修改演示内容。
🔧 高级配置与优化
服务器配置最佳实践
修改config/config.example.js文件,配置以下关键参数:
httpAddress: '0.0.0.0', httpPort: 8080, storage: '/data/cryptpad'性能调优策略
- 启用Gzip压缩减少传输数据量
- 配置适当的缓存策略
- 定期清理临时文件
安全加固措施
- 定期更新加密密钥
- 配置访问日志监控
- 设置防火墙规则限制访问
🎯 企业应用场景
研发团队代码协作
通过www/code/模块支持代码文件的实时编辑和版本管理,特别适合敏捷开发团队。
市场部门内容创作
文档和演示文稿功能帮助市场团队快速制作营销材料和方案。
项目管理与规划
看板和任务管理功能支持项目进度跟踪和团队协作。
🛠️ 故障排查与维护
常见问题解决方案
- 端口占用:修改默认端口或停止冲突服务
- 权限错误:检查文件系统读写权限
- 内存不足:增加服务器内存或优化配置
日常维护任务
- 定期备份重要数据
- 监控系统资源使用
- 更新到最新版本
📈 扩展与集成
第三方系统对接
CryptPad支持与多种企业系统集成,包括Nextcloud、OnlyOffice等。
定制化开发
基于开源代码,企业可根据特定需求进行功能定制和二次开发。
结语
CryptPad不仅是一个协作工具,更是企业数字化转型的重要基础设施。通过本指南,你可以快速搭建一个安全可靠的企业级协作平台,为团队提供全方位的加密协作支持。
记住,在数据安全日益重要的今天,选择CryptPad就是选择对团队隐私的最大尊重和保护。
【免费下载链接】cryptpadCollaborative office suite, end-to-end encrypted and open-source.项目地址: https://gitcode.com/gh_mirrors/cr/cryptpad
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考